Output 6f44668afd734bedeffcf7e31c7a4261fdeb0a117944d1860128cd4fa00213f2:0

value
58562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2775527e947eea08b70c4d79e5b15372f779675 OP_EQUAL
address
3Po4QLuC4VaLFnWGQh7w7hUYW4hbQLfVRv
transaction
6f44668afd734bedeffcf7e31c7a4261fdeb0a117944d1860128cd4fa00213f2
confirmations
54647
spent
true